LVM vergrössern

Mike

Grand Admiral Special
Mitglied seit
11.11.2001
Beiträge
5.089
Renomée
103
Standort
Bayern
Hallo

Ich habe Linux (Solus) auf einen USB Stick installiert und war bisher zufrieden damit.
Nun habe ich meine alte 960 Evo via IcyBox an USB angeschlossen und Solus mit Clonezilla kopiert.
Soweit so gut.
Nun habe ich allerdings das System immer noch mit 128GB die SSD hat aber 500GB.
Der rest liegt auf einer neuen Partition.
Wenn ich die LVM jetzt mit dem Partitions Manager erweitere startet das System nicht mehr.

Hat da jemand eine genaue Vorgehensweise wie man die LVM erweitern kann ?
 
Du kannst es mit gparted probieren. Der freie Speicher sollte sich man besten vor oder nach der Partition befinden, die du vergrößern willst.
 
Gparted macht da gar nix, ist alles ausgegraut.

Habe jetzt zumindest mal auf 230GB erweitern können mit den Befehlen....

lvextend -l +100%FREE /dev/mapper/SolusSystem-Root
resize2fs /dev/mapper/SolusSystem-Root
 
zuerst mit pvresize das physische volume der vg vergrößern.
Dann sollte auch der Rest gehen

Zeig uns mal ein fdisk -l von der disk.
 
Festplatte /dev/sdd: 465,76 GiB, 500107862016 Bytes, 976773168 Sektoren
Festplattenmodell: SSD 960 EVO
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 4096 Bytes
E/A-Größe (minimal/optimal): 4096 Bytes / 4096 Bytes
Festplattenbezeichnungstyp: dos
Festplattenbezeichner: 0x815fdcb7

Gerät Boot Anfang Ende Sektoren Größe Kn Typ
/dev/sdd1 * 2048 1953578 1951531 952,9M 83 Linux
/dev/sdd2 1953579 976761224 974807646 464,8G 8e Linux LVM


Festplatte /dev/mapper/SolusSystem-Swap: 3,73 GiB, 4001366016 Bytes, 7815168 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 4096 Bytes
E/A-Größe (minimal/optimal): 4096 Bytes / 4096 Bytes
Ausrichtungs-Position: 2560 Byte

Festplatte /dev/mapper/SolusSystem-Root: 234,8 GiB, 252119613440 Bytes, 492421120 Sektoren
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 4096 Bytes
E/A-Größe (minimal/optimal): 4096 Bytes / 4096 Bytes
Ausrichtungs-Position: 2560 Byte
 
Zuletzt bearbeitet:
ok,

da sieht man, dass die sdd2 lvm partition schon am Ende des Device ist.
Damit passt das schon mal.

pvdisplay /dev/sdd sollte die gleiche Größe zeigen, sonst sollte pvresize das ändern.
vgdisplay /dev/SolusSystem sollte auch die richtige Größe und freie LE zeigen.
vgs zeigt eine verkürzte form davon

Wenn das alles passt, sollte mit lvextend die Größe anpassbar sein.
Je nach Dateisystem musst Du dann auch dieses letztendlich vergrößern.
In ext4 z.B. mit resize2fs /dev/SolusSystem-Root

Wo ist Deine boot Partition? Keine EFI Partition hier?
Ist das kein EFI System?

Falls Du grub als Bootloader hast, dann mach auch nach der Vergrößerung ein update davon.
 
Ich dachte eigentlich daß sdd1 die efi ist.
PVdisplay zeigt gar nichts.

root@solus /home/mike # pvdisplay /dev/sdd
Failed to find physical volume "/dev/sdd".

--- Volume group ---
VG Name SolusSystem
System ID
Format lvm2
Metadata Areas 1
Metadata Sequence No 5
VG Access read/write
VG Status resizable
MAX LV 0
Cur LV 2
Open LV 2
Max PV 0
Cur PV 1
Act PV 1
VG Size 238,53 GiB
PE Size 4,00 MiB
Total PE 61064
Alloc PE / Size 61064 / 238,53 GiB
Free PE / Size 0 / 0
VG UUID VSBfYC-h8Wo-53vI-2xlc-ojt5-1rFA-Q1zA2G
 
Zuletzt bearbeitet:
Ich dachte sdd ist dein device.
Nur pvdisplay zeigt einfach alle Platten mit lvm

Man sieht oben, dass die vg nur 253G groß ist.
Das gehört geändert.
 
Meine Hauptplatte ist eine M2

estplatte /dev/nvme0n1: 1,82 TiB, 2000398934016 Bytes, 3907029168 Sektoren
Festplattenmodell: Samsung SSD 970 EVO Plus 2TB
Einheiten: Sektoren von 1 * 512 = 512 Bytes
Sektorgröße (logisch/physikalisch): 512 Bytes / 512 Bytes
E/A-Größe (minimal/optimal): 512 Bytes / 512 Bytes
Festplattenbezeichnungstyp: gpt
Festplattenbezeichner: A13E78FC-0F6F-45B1-882B-0BE7F761B4B7

Gerät Anfang Ende Sektoren Größe Typ
/dev/nvme0n1p1 5775360 3535667199 3529891840 1,6T Microsoft Basisdaten
/dev/nvme0n1p2 2048 4531608 4529561 2,2G Microsoft Basisdaten
/dev/nvme0n1p3 4546560 5775359 1228800 600M Microsoft Basisdaten

Partitionstabelleneinträge sind nicht in Festplatten-Reihenfolge.
 
Was hat die nvme Platte mit dem was du auf der sata ssd tun willst zu tun?
Falls Du damit meinst auf der nvme Platte ist die EFI Partition, heißt das Du musst dort die Booteinträge für die sata ssd anpassen.
Das müsste in der Doku von Solus zu finden sein.
Hat aber eigentlich nicht wirklich was mit der Größe des Dateisystems auf der sata ssd zu tun (sollte es zumindest)
 
Sieht eigentlich jetzt ganz gut aus.

--- Volume group ---
VG Name SolusSystem
System ID
Format lvm2
Metadata Areas 1
Metadata Sequence No 7
VG Access read/write
VG Status resizable
MAX LV 0
Cur LV 2
Open LV 2
Max PV 0
Cur PV 1
Act PV 1
VG Size 464,82 GiB
PE Size 4,00 MiB
Total PE 118994
Alloc PE / Size 118994 / 464,82 GiB
Free PE / Size 0 / 0
VG UUID VSBfYC-h8Wo-53vI-2xlc-ojt5-1rFA-Q1zA2G

--- Physical volume ---
PV Name /dev/sdd2
VG Name SolusSystem
PV Size 464,82 GiB / not usable <3,30 MiB
Allocatable yes (but full)
PE Size 4,00 MiB
Total PE 118994
Free PE 0
Allocated PE 118994
PV UUID nLKrno-Ufek-ww0W-7CjQ-BpSG-2jXH-tvvIUZ

Vielen Dank für deine Hilfe.

Muss ich jetzt grub noch updaten und warum ?
 
Weil du sagtest, dass du nach Vergrößerung nicht booten kannst.
 
Zurück
Oben Unten